'Blütenkranz: Morgenländischer Dichtung' is an anthology of poetry translated from Asian languages. Compiled by Heinrich Jolowicz, this collection presents a diverse range of voices and styles, offering readers a glimpse into the rich literary traditions of the East. The poems explore universal themes of love, nature, spirituality, and the human condition, rendered in evocative language. This volume serves as a valuable resource for students and enthusiasts of world literature, providing access to works that might otherwise remain inaccessible to English-speaking audiences.
